Verteilte Systeme Beispiele für Anwendungen und Technologien

Verteilte Systeme sind aus unserem modernen Alltag nicht mehr wegzudenken. Sie ermöglichen es uns, Daten und Ressourcen über verschiedene Standorte hinweg zu teilen und zu verwalten. In diesem Artikel beleuchten wir verschiedene verteilte Systeme Beispiele, die in zahlreichen Anwendungen zum Einsatz kommen.

Ob Cloud-Computing oder Peer-to-Peer-Netzwerke – die Technologien hinter den verteilten Systemen revolutionieren unsere Art zu arbeiten und zu kommunizieren. Wir werden eine Vielzahl von Beispielen betrachten, um ein besseres Verständnis für ihre Funktionsweise und ihren Nutzen zu gewinnen. Wie beeinflussen diese Systeme unseren Alltag?

Lassen Sie uns gemeinsam die faszinierende Welt der verteilten Systeme erkunden und herausfinden, welche innovativen Lösungen sie bieten. Sind Sie bereit, die Möglichkeiten dieser Technologien zu entdecken?

Verteilte Systeme Beispiele in der Praxis

Verteilte Systeme finden in der Praxis vielfältige Anwendungen, die ihre Effizienz und Flexibilität unter Beweis stellen. Durch die Verteilung von Ressourcen und Aufgaben auf verschiedene Knotenpunkte ermöglichen sie eine bessere Nutzung von Rechenleistung, Speicher und Netzwerkbandbreite. In den folgenden Abschnitten werden einige exemplarische Anwendungsfälle vorgestellt, die verdeutlichen, wie Unternehmen verteilte Systeme erfolgreich implementieren.

Cloud Computing

Ein herausragendes Beispiel für verteilte Systeme ist das Cloud Computing. Unternehmen nutzen cloudbasierte Dienste wie Amazon Web Services oder Microsoft Azure, um Infrastrukturressourcen flexibel bereitzustellen. Die Vorteile liegen auf der Hand:

  • Kosteneffizienz: Reduzierung der Investitionskosten durch bedarfsorientierte Abrechnung.
  • Skalierbarkeit: Möglichkeit zur Anpassung an steigende Anforderungen in Echtzeit.
  • Zugänglichkeit: Daten und Anwendungen sind ortsunabhängig zugänglich.

Diese Aspekte machen Cloud-Lösungen zu einem unverzichtbaren Bestandteil vieler Geschäftsmodelle.

Peer-to-Peer Netzwerke

Ein weiteres praktisches Beispiel sind Peer-to-Peer (P2P) Netzwerke, wie sie bei File-Sharing-Diensten oder Kryptowährungen vorkommen. Bei diesen Systemen kommunizieren Endgeräte direkt miteinander, ohne dass ein zentraler Server benötigt wird. Die wichtigsten Merkmale dieser Technologie sind:

  • Dezentralisierung: Erhöhung der Resilienz gegenüber Ausfällen einzelner Knoten.
  • Effiziente Ressourcennutzung: Bessere Auslastung verfügbarer Bandbreite und Rechenleistung.
  • Anonymität: Nutzer können sicherer agieren.

Solche P2P-Strukturen fördern nicht nur den Datenaustausch, sondern auch innovative Ansätze im Bereich digitaler Währungen.

Internet of Things (IoT)

Das Internet der Dinge stellt ein weiteres bedeutendes Anwendungsfeld für verteilte Systeme dar. Geräte sammeln Daten autonom und kommunizieren über das Internet miteinander. Beispiele hierfür sind:

Gerätetyp Anwendung
Smart Home Automatisierung von Haushaltsgeräten
Wearables Gesundheitsüberwachung
Industrielle Sensoren Produktionsoptimierung

Durch diese Vernetzung entstehen neue Möglichkeiten zur Datenanalyse und Prozessoptimierung in verschiedenen Branchen.

Die oben genannten Beispiele zeigen eindrücklich, wie vielseitig verteile Systeme in der Praxis eingesetzt werden können. Ihre Fähigkeit zur Verbesserung von Effizienz und Flexibilität hat sie zu einem wesentlichen Element moderner Technologien gemacht.

Weitere Artikel:  Satz von Vieta: Beispiele und Anwendungen in der Mathematik

Anwendungen Verteilter Systeme in Unternehmen

Verteilte Systeme haben sich in Unternehmen als entscheidend für die Optimierung von Prozessen und die Steigerung der Effizienz erwiesen. Sie ermöglichen nicht nur die gleichzeitige Verarbeitung großer Datenmengen, sondern fördern auch die Zusammenarbeit zwischen verschiedenen Abteilungen und Standorten. In dieser Sektion werden einige spezifische Anwendungen beleuchtet, die aufzeigen, wie Unternehmen verteilte Systeme erfolgreich nutzen, um ihre Geschäftsziele zu erreichen.

Supply Chain Management

Ein wesentliches Anwendungsfeld für verteilte Systeme ist das Supply Chain Management (SCM). Durch den Einsatz solcher Technologien können Unternehmen ihre Lieferketten effizienter gestalten. Die Vorteile umfassen:

  • Echtzeit-Transparenz: Alle Beteiligten erhalten sofortige Informationen über den Status von Bestellungen und Lagerbeständen.
  • Optimierte Logistik: Routenplanung und -optimierung erfolgen dynamisch basierend auf aktuellen Daten.
  • Kollaboration: Partnerunternehmen können nahtlos zusammenarbeiten, was zu schnelleren Reaktionszeiten führt.

Die Implementierung eines verteilten Systems im SCM reduziert nicht nur Kosten, sondern verbessert auch den Kundenservice erheblich.

Finanzdienstleistungen

In der Finanzbranche sind verteilte Systeme unerlässlich geworden. Banken und Finanzinstitute setzen sie ein, um Transaktionen sicherer und effizienter abzuwickeln. Die wichtigsten Aspekte sind:

  • Sicherheit: Durch kryptographische Verfahren wird das Risiko von Betrug minimiert.
  • Schnelligkeit: Transaktionen werden in Echtzeit verarbeitet.
  • Zugänglichkeit: Kunden können unabhängig von ihrem Standort auf Dienstleistungen zugreifen.

Diese Faktoren tragen dazu bei, dass sich Finanzinstitute schnell an Marktveränderungen anpassen können.

Datenanalyse und Business Intelligence

Ein weiteres Beispiel für den Einsatz verteilte Systeme ist in der Datenanalyse und Business Intelligence zu finden. Unternehmen nutzen diese Technologien zur Verarbeitung riesiger Datenmengen aus unterschiedlichen Quellen. Zu den Vorteilen gehören:

Aspekt Vorteil
Datenintegration Kombination verschiedener Datensätze zur umfassenden Analyse.
Echtzeitanalysen Schnelle Entscheidungen basierend auf aktuelle Trends.
Skalierbarkeit Möglichkeit zur Anpassung an wachsende Datenanforderungen.

Durch den effektiven Einsatz verteilter Systeme gelingt es Unternehmen, datengetriebene Entscheidungen schneller zu treffen und Wettbewerbsvorteile auszubauen.

Die genannten Beispiele illustrieren eindrucksvoll das Potenzial verteilter Systeme in Unternehmensanwendungen. Ihre vielseitigen Einsatzmöglichkeiten tragen maßgeblich dazu bei, Prozesse zu optimieren und innovative Lösungen voranzutreiben.

Technologien Hinter Verteilten Systemen

Verteilte Systeme basieren auf einer Vielzahl von Technologien, die ihre Funktionalität und Effizienz gewährleisten. Diese Technologien ermöglichen es Unternehmen, Daten sicher zu speichern, effizient zu verarbeiten und in Echtzeit darauf zuzugreifen. Im Folgenden betrachten wir einige der Schlüsseltechnologien, die hinter verteilten Systemen stehen und deren Bedeutung für verschiedene Anwendungen herausstellen.

Cloud Computing

Cloud Computing ist eine fundamentale Technologie für verteilte Systeme. Sie ermöglicht den Zugriff auf Rechenressourcen über das Internet und bietet Flexibilität sowie Skalierbarkeit. Zu den Vorteilen zählen:

  • Kosteneffizienz: Reduzierung der Investitionskosten durch nutzungsbasierte Abrechnung.
  • Flexibilität: Anpassung der Ressourcen an die aktuellen Anforderungen.
  • Zugänglichkeit: Überall verfügbarer Zugriff auf Daten und Anwendungen.
Weitere Artikel:  Ironie Beispiele: Typen und ihre Anwendung im Alltag

Diese Eigenschaften machen Cloud-Dienste ideal für Unternehmen, die verteilte Systeme implementieren möchten.

Microservices-Architektur

Die Microservices-Architektur ist ein weiterer wichtiger Baustein für moderne verteilte Systeme. Sie teilt Anwendungen in kleine, unabhängige Dienste auf, die miteinander kommunizieren können. Vorteile dieser Architektur sind:

  • Unabhängigkeit: Jeder Dienst kann unabhängig entwickelt und skaliert werden.
  • Fehlerisolierung: Probleme in einem Dienst beeinträchtigen nicht notwendigerweise andere Teile des Systems.
  • Technologische Vielfalt: Verschiedene Programmiersprachen oder Frameworks können je nach Anforderung eingesetzt werden.

Durch diese Struktur können Unternehmen agiler arbeiten und schneller Innovationen vorantreiben.

Blockchain-Technologie

Blockchain hat sich als revolutionär in der Welt verteilter Systeme etabliert, insbesondere im Hinblick auf Sicherheit und Transparenz. Die wichtigsten Merkmale sind:

Aspekt Vorteil
Sicherheit Dezentralisierte Speicherung reduziert Betrugsrisiken.
Transparenz Alle Transaktionen sind nachvollziehbar und unveränderlich.
Zugänglichkeit Kollaboration zwischen verschiedenen Akteuren wird erleichtert.

Die Integration von Blockchain-Technologie in verteilte Systeme eröffnet neue Möglichkeiten zur Gestaltung sicherer Transaktionen und zur Vertrauensbildung zwischen Partnern.

Diese Technologien bilden das Rückgrat erfolgreicher verteilter Systeme in Unternehmen. Indem wir sie effektiv nutzen, schaffen wir nicht nur robuste Infrastrukturen sondern auch innovative Lösungen zur Erreichung unserer Geschäftsziele.

Vorteile und Herausforderungen Verteilter Systeme

Verteilte Systeme bieten zahlreiche Vorteile, die sie für Unternehmen und Anwendungen attraktiv machen. Diese Systeme ermöglichen es uns, Ressourcen effizient zu nutzen, die Skalierbarkeit zu erhöhen und eine höhere Verfügbarkeit sicherzustellen. Dennoch sind mit der Implementierung und dem Betrieb verteilter Systeme auch Herausforderungen verbunden, die wir berücksichtigen sollten.

Ein bedeutender Vorteil ist die Skalierbarkeit, da wir durch verteilte Architektur leicht zusätzliche Ressourcen hinzufügen können, um den wachsenden Anforderungen gerecht zu werden. Zudem erhöht sich die Fehlertoleranz, da Ausfälle einzelner Komponenten nicht zwangsläufig das gesamte System beeinträchtigen. Ein weiterer Aspekt ist die Ressourcenteilung, wodurch Kosten gesenkt werden können.

Trotz dieser Vorteile stehen wir jedoch vor mehreren Herausforderungen:

  • Komplexität: Die Verwaltung von verteilten Systemen erfordert spezialisierte Kenntnisse und kann komplexe Interaktionen zwischen verschiedenen Komponenten beinhalten.
  • Synchronisation: Die Gewährleistung der Datenkonsistenz über verschiedene Knoten hinweg kann schwierig sein, insbesondere in Echtzeitanwendungen.
  • Sicherheitsrisiken: Da Daten über Netzwerke verteilt sind, steigt das Risiko von Sicherheitsverletzungen und Cyberangriffen.

Technologische Herausforderungen

Die technologische Basis verteilter Systeme bringt spezifische Herausforderungen mit sich:

  1. Netzwerkabhängigkeit: Die Leistung des Systems hängt stark von der Netzwerkverbindung ab. Verzögerungen oder Unterbrechungen können den gesamten Betrieb stören.
  2. Datenmanagement: Das Management großer Datenmengen in einer verteilten Umgebung erfordert effektive Lösungen zur Speicherung und Verarbeitung.
  3. Interoperabilität: Verschiedene Technologien müssen nahtlos zusammenarbeiten, was oft Standardisierung und Anpassung voraussetzt.
Weitere Artikel:  Saisonale Schwankungen Beispiele in verschiedenen Branchen

Strategien zur Überwindung der Herausforderungen

Um diese Herausforderungen erfolgreich zu meistern, können bestimmte Strategien implementiert werden:

  • Einführung von Monitoring-Lösungen zur kontinuierlichen Überwachung des Systems.
  • Verwendung bewährter Praktiken für Sicherheit wie Verschlüsselung und Zugriffskontrollen.
  • Schulungsprogramme für Mitarbeiter zur Steigerung des Fachwissens im Umgang mit verteilten Systemen.

Indem wir sowohl die Vorteile als auch die Herausforderungen anerkennen und strategisch angehen, können wir das Potenzial verteilter Systeme optimal nutzen und innovative Lösungen entwickeln, die unseren Geschäftsanforderungen entsprechen.

Zukunftsperspektiven für Verteilte Systeme

In Anbetracht der rasanten technologischen Entwicklungen und des zunehmenden Bedarfs an flexiblen, effizienten Lösungen ist die Zukunft verteilter Systeme vielversprechend. Die fortwährende Digitalisierung in nahezu allen Lebensbereichen treibt die Implementierung dieser Systeme voran, wodurch sie weiterhin eine zentrale Rolle in der IT-Infrastruktur vieler Unternehmen spielen werden. Wir sehen bereits jetzt einen Trend zu einer stärkeren Integration von Technologien wie Künstliche Intelligenz (KI) und dem Internet der Dinge (IoT), die das Potenzial verteilter Systeme weiter erhöhen.

Erweiterte Anwendungen

Verteilte Systeme werden zunehmend in neuen Bereichen eingesetzt. Beispiele hierfür sind:

  • Smart Cities: Hier ermöglichen verteilte Systeme eine nahtlose Kommunikation zwischen verschiedenen städtischen Infrastrukturen, was zu effizienteren Verkehrsflüssen und besserem Ressourcenmanagement führt.
  • Blockchain-Technologie: Diese Technologie nutzt verteilte Systeme zur Sicherstellung von Transparenz und Sicherheit bei Transaktionen.
  • Energieverteilung: Dezentrale Energiesysteme nutzen verteilte Ansätze zur Optimierung des Energieverbrauchs und zur Förderung erneuerbarer Energien.

Künftige Herausforderungen und Lösungen

Trotz der positiven Perspektiven stehen wir vor neuen Herausforderungen, die es zu bewältigen gilt. Dazu gehören:

  • Sicherheitsanforderungen: Mit dem Wachstum verteilter Systeme nimmt auch das Risiko cyberkrimineller Angriffe zu. Innovative Sicherheitslösungen müssen entwickelt werden, um Datenintegrität zu gewährleisten.
  • Datenmanagement-Komplexität: Die Verwaltung großer Datenmengen erfordert intelligente Algorithmen zur Analyse und Verarbeitung in Echtzeit.
  • Anpassungsfähigkeit an neue Technologien: Verteilte Systeme müssen flexibel genug sein, um sich an schnell ändernde technologische Landschaften anzupassen.

Um diesen Herausforderungen erfolgreich zu begegnen, sollten Unternehmen proaktive Strategien entwickeln. Der Einsatz moderner Monitoring-Tools kann helfen, potenzielle Probleme frühzeitig zu erkennen. Zudem ist es wichtig, kontinuierlich in Schulungsprogramme für Mitarbeitende zu investieren, um deren Wissen über moderne Technologien auf dem neuesten Stand zu halten.

Letztendlich wird die Kombination aus innovativen Anwendungen und effektiven Lösungsansätzen dazu beitragen, dass verteilte Systeme nicht nur Bestand haben, sondern auch als treibende Kraft für zukünftige digitale Transformationen fungieren können.

Schreibe einen Kommentar